일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- 반복실행구조
- 논리연산
- 딥러닝
- 출력
- 불 연산
- 산술연산
- 불 자료형
- 비트단위논리연산
- codeup
- 파이썬
- 진수
- 16진수
- 코드업
- Docker
- 8진수
- 입출력
- 아스키코드
- face recognition
- 비교연산
- 2진수
- input()
- bitwise
- 문자열
- 기초 100제
- 선택실행구조
- 기초100제
- OpenCV
- 2차원배열
- 종합
- 10진수
- Today
- Total
목록
728x90
반응형
SMALL
알고리즘/코드업 (94)
DeepFlowest
문제 : 두 가지의 참(1) 또는 거짓(0)이 입력될 때, 참/거짓이 서로 다를 때에만 참을 출력하는 프로그램을 작성해보자. [참고] 이러한 논리연산을 XOR(exclusive or, 배타적 논리합)연산이라고도 부른다. 집합의 의미로는 합집합에서 교집합을 뺀 것을 의미한다. 모두 같은 의미이다. 논리연산자는 사칙연산자와 마찬가지로 여러 번 중복해서 사용할 수 있는데, 연산의 순서를 만들어주기 위해 괄호 ( )를 사용해 묶어 주면 된다. 답 :
문제 : 두 개의 참(1) 또는 거짓(0)이 입력될 때, 하나라도 참이면 참을 출력하는 프로그램을 작성해보자. [참고] 논리연산자 || 는 주어진 2개의 논리값 중에 하나라도 참(1) 이면 1(참)로 계산하고, 그 외의 경우에는 0(거짓) 으로 계산한다. ** | 기호는 쉬프트를 누른 상태에서 백슬래시(\)를 누르면 나오는 기호로, 버티컬 바(vertical bar) 기호이다. 이러한 논리연산을 OR 연산이라고도 부르고, + 로 표시하며, 집합 기호로는 ∪(합집합, union)을 사용한다. 모두 같은 의미이다. 참, 거짓의 논리값(boolean value)인 불 값을 다루어주는 논리연산자는 !(not), &&(and), ||(or) 이 있다. 답 : 방법1 방법2
문제 : [참고] 논리연산자 && 는 주어진 2개의 논리값이 모두 참(1) 일 때에만 1(참)로 계산하고, 그 외의 경우에는 0(거짓) 으로 계산한다. 이러한 논리연산을 AND 연산이라고도 부르고, · 으로 표시하거나 생략하며, 집합 기호로는 ∩(교집합, intersection)을 의미한다. 모두 같은 의미이다. 참, 거짓의 논리값(boolean value)인 불 값을 다루어주는 논리연산자는 !(not), &&(and), ||(or) 이 있다. 답 : 방법1 방법2 방법3 방법4 [오류] and 쓸 때 다음과 같은 오류를 조심하자. 설명 : 불 자료형 / 연산 정리 부분 참고 ==> https://deepflowest.tistory.com/55
문제 : 1(true, 참) 또는 0(false, 거짓) 이 입력되었을 때 반대로 출력하는 프로그램을 작성해보자. [참고] 비교/관계 연산(==, !=, >, =, https://deepflowest.tistory.com/55
문제 : 두 정수(a, b)를 입력받아 a와 b가 서로 다르면 1을, 그렇지 않으면 0을 출력하는 프로그램을 작성해보자. 답 :
문제 : 두 정수(a, b)를 입력받아 b가 a보다 크거나 같으면 1을, 그렇지 않으면 0을 출력하는 프로그램을 작성해보자. 답 :
문제 : 두 정수(a, b)를 입력받아 a와 b가 같으면 1을, 같지 않으면 0을 출력하는 프로그램을 작성해보자. 답 :
문제 : 두 정수(a, b)를 입력받아 a가 b보다 크면 1을, a가 b보다 작거나 같으면 0을 출력하는 프로그램을 작성해보자. 답 :